Transaction 293ea101d178bb42518376e243b4f9cf9182b08ecf1657f8d7208497eb058072

1 Input
1 Outputs
  • 293ea101d178bb42518376e243b4f9cf9182b08ecf1657f8d7208497eb058072:0
  • value  25940
    address  3H6yFJUfqztxZ5ZXeqWW8WM2DedxAX7R9p